Acts 27:3 WEB

1  When it was determined that we should sail for Italy, they delivered Paul and certain other prisoners to a centurion named Julius, of the Augustan band.

2  Embarking in a ship of Adramyttium, which was about to sail to places on the coast of Asia, we put to sea; Aristarchus, a Macedonian of Thessalonica, being with us.

3  The next day, we touched at Sidon. Julius treated Paul kindly, and gave him permission to go to his friends and refresh himself.

4  Putting to sea from there, we sailed under the lee of Cyprus, because the winds were contrary.

5  When we had sailed across the sea which is off Cilicia and Pamphylia, we came to Myra, a city of Lycia.
